St. Anthony City, Idaho


St. Anthony City is a city in the Fremont County, Idaho, United States. As per the 2000 census, city has a population of 3342 inhabitants. The city's estimated population as of July 2008 was 3401, making it the 38th most populous in Idaho. It has total area of 1.32 sq mi (3.42 sq km), of which, 1.3 square miles (3.37 sq km) of it is land and 0.01 square miles (0.03 sq km) of it is water, it is the 74th largest by area in the U.S. state of Idaho.

As of the census of 2000, there were 3342 residents, 1091 households, and 819 families in the city. The population density was 2565 people per square mile (990.35/kmē), it is Idaho's 21st most densely populated city. There were 1218 housing units at an average density of 936.9 per square mile (361.74/kmē). The average household size was 2.94 and the average family size was 3.47. In the city the population is diverse age-wise, with 33.2% under the age of 18, 10.1% from 18 to 24, 26.8% from 25 to 44, 18.5% from 45 to 64, and 11.4% who were 65 or older. For every 100 females there were 107.6 males. For every 100 females age 18 and over, there were 109.8 males. The median age was 30 years, The median age of males and females living in St. Anthony City was 29.6 and 30.5 years respectively. The racial or ethnic makeup of the city was 2976 White, 7 Black or African American, 23 American Indian, 22 Asian, 2 Native Hawaiian, 75 from two or more races and 237 Ohter races.

The median income for a household in the city was $31023, it is Idaho's 99th wealthiest city by median household income. The median income for a family in the city was $37995, making it the 83rd wealthiest city by median family income among the Idaho. The per capita income for the city was $12898, it is the 68th poorest city in terms of per capita income. The median income of city was $16194, The median income for males was $20417 versus $11647 for females.

In 2000, 879 pupils and students, of which 54.27% are male and 45.73% are female, 26.3% of the total population, are in the education system. Of which, percentage of enrollment student are in, 5.57% nursery or pri school, 7.62% kindergarten, 52.67% elementary school, 26.28% high school and 7.85% College graduate school.
